Overview
Englaim (also called En Eglaim) appears primarily in Ezekiel's prophecy concerning the future healing of the Dead Sea. Located on the eastern shore of the Dead Sea, this place symbolizes restoration and life in God's end-times plan for Israel. The reference to Englaim highlights how even desolate regions will experience supernatural transformation and blessing.
Key Scriptures
"Fishermen will stand along the shore; from En Gedi to En Eglaim there will be places for spreading nets. The fish will be of many kinds—like the fish of the Mediterranean Sea." (Ezekiel 47:10, NIV)
